Understanding Mold Growth in Water
Mold thrives in damp, warm environments, and water that has been left stagnant or contaminated can quickly become a breeding ground for various mold species. Unlike visible mold on surfaces like walls or food, mold in water may not always be apparent by sight or smell, making it a hidden hazard. When water is stored improperly—such as in old pipes, containers, or water tanks without proper cleaning—it can develop mold colonies that release spores and mycotoxins.
The presence of mold in water is often linked to poor hygiene and inadequate maintenance of plumbing systems. Stagnant water inside pipes or containers allows organic matter to accumulate, providing nutrients for mold growth. This can happen in household settings with old plumbing or outdoor water sources exposed to environmental contaminants.
Moldy water doesn’t just look unappealing; it poses real health risks. The microscopic spores released into the air or ingested through drinking contaminated water are the primary concern. These spores can trigger allergic reactions, respiratory problems, and infections depending on the type of mold and the individual’s immune response.
Health Risks Linked to Moldy Water Exposure
Exposure to moldy water can cause a range of health issues that vary from mild irritation to severe illness. The severity depends on factors such as the type of mold present, the amount of exposure, and individual susceptibility.
- Allergic Reactions: Mold spores are common allergens. People exposed to moldy water might experience sneezing, runny nose, itchy eyes, and skin rashes.
- Respiratory Problems: Inhaling airborne spores from mold-contaminated water sources can lead to coughing, wheezing, asthma exacerbation, and other respiratory difficulties.
- Mycotoxin Exposure: Certain molds produce toxic compounds called mycotoxins which can cause neurological symptoms, fatigue, nausea, and immune suppression when ingested or inhaled over time.
- Infections: Immunocompromised individuals face higher risks of fungal infections if they consume or come into contact with moldy water.
Children, elderly people, pregnant women, and those with pre-existing lung conditions are especially vulnerable. Even healthy adults may experience mild symptoms like headaches or digestive upset after consuming contaminated water.
Mold Species Commonly Found in Water
Not all molds are created equal when it comes to health risks. Here are some common molds found in contaminated water sources:
| Mold Species | Health Effects | Common Sources |
|---|---|---|
| Aspergillus | Allergic reactions; respiratory infections; mycotoxin production | Damp pipes; stagnant water tanks; soil-contaminated water |
| Penicillium | Allergies; asthma triggers; potential mycotoxin exposure | Water-damaged materials; old plumbing systems; humid environments |
| Cladosporium | Mild allergic reactions; respiratory irritation | Outdoor water sources; rainwater collection systems; wet surfaces |
Knowing which molds are present helps determine the potential health impact and guides remediation efforts.

The Role of Immune Response in Illness Severity
Whether someone gets sick after exposure depends largely on their immune system’s ability to fight off fungal agents. Healthy individuals often clear small amounts of spores without symptoms. However:
- People with allergies may experience heightened immune responses.
- Those with asthma might suffer exacerbations.
- Immunocompromised patients risk serious fungal infections requiring medical intervention.
This variability explains why some people feel fine after drinking questionable tap water while others develop severe symptoms rapidly.
Detecting Mold Contamination in Water Supplies
Spotting mold contamination isn’t always straightforward because it doesn’t always alter the taste or smell noticeably at first. However:
- Cloudiness or discoloration might indicate microbial growth.
- A musty odor near faucets or storage tanks suggests fungal activity.
- Visible slime or deposits inside pipes signal biofilm formation where molds thrive.
Testing is essential for confirmation. Water samples sent for laboratory analysis can detect fungal DNA or identify specific molds present through culture techniques.
Several commercial test kits also provide preliminary screening options for homeowners concerned about their tap or stored water quality.
Preventive Measures Against Moldy Water Risks
Keeping your water free from mold requires vigilance:
- Regular Cleaning: Clean storage tanks and containers thoroughly every few months.
- Avoid Stagnation: Use fresh water regularly instead of letting it sit for extended periods.
- Maintain Plumbing: Repair leaks promptly and replace old pipes prone to corrosion.
- Filtration Systems: Install filters capable of removing microbial contaminants.
- Adequate Ventilation: Reduce humidity near plumbing areas to discourage fungal growth.
Simple steps like these drastically reduce the chance that your drinking supply becomes a health hazard due to molds.
Treatment Options After Exposure to Moldy Water
If you suspect illness caused by ingesting or inhaling mold-contaminated water:
- See a healthcare provider promptly.
- Describe your symptoms clearly along with any known exposure history.
- Diagnostic tests may include blood work for allergic markers or cultures for fungal infection.
Treatment varies depending on severity but often includes:
- Antihistamines: To relieve allergy symptoms like sneezing and itching.
- Corticosteroids: For inflammation control in respiratory conditions.
- Antifungal Medications: In cases where fungal infections develop.
- Supportive Care: Hydration and rest if gastrointestinal upset occurs.
Early intervention improves outcomes significantly by preventing complications such as chronic lung disease or systemic infection.
